I/OAT: cleanup pci issues
authorShannon Nelson <shannon.nelson@intel.com>
Thu, 18 Oct 2007 10:07:12 +0000 (03:07 -0700)
committerLinus Torvalds <torvalds@woody.linux-foundation.org>
Thu, 18 Oct 2007 21:37:32 +0000 (14:37 -0700)
Reorder the pci release actions
    Letting go of the resources in the right order helps get rid of
    occasional kernel complaints.

Fix the pci_driver object name [Randy Dunlap]
    Rename the struct pci_driver data so that false section mismatch
    warnings won't be produced.
